Etymology[edit]
From Proto-Indo-European *knew-, *kenw- (“to scratch, scrape, rub”).

Descendants[edit]
- Old English: *hnēopan (in combination: āhnēopan)
- Old Norse: *hnjúpa
- Gothic: *𐌷𐌽𐌹𐌿𐍀𐌰𐌽 (*hniupan) (in combination: 𐌳𐌹𐍃𐌷𐌽𐌹𐌿𐍀𐌰𐌽 (dishniupan))
